Valencia College offers courses that must be taken together in the same term/semester. These courses are linked together as corequisites in registration and require you to be registered in each course that is linked to the other(s). An example of courses that may be linked together are EMS 1119 Fundamentals of Emergency Medical Technology, EMS 1119L Fundamentals of Emergency Medical Technology Practice, and EMS 1431L Emergency Medical Technician Clinical Practicum.
You can search for courses that are linked together as corequisites via the Class Schedule Search:

Access the Class Schedule Search via the Valencia College public website or via your Atlas account
-
Select the Term you wish to perform your linked classes search for and click Continue:
-
Click on Advanced Search to display the additional search criteria field options:
-
Locate the Class Type search criteria field:
Click inside the Class Type field to open a drop-down menu; select Linked Classes by clicking on it:
-
Click the Search button to generate the search results:
-
-
If linked classes are being offered for the Term you selected, they will display on the Search Results page:
-
To view which classes are linked together, click on the Title of the course:
-
In the window that opens, click on Corequisites:
-
All of the classes that are linked to this one will be shown:
